Output e8c6c47d29fe8a4007978758be964fa8663b9cc05ac6b251580f07b4453a1671:1

value
39019155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a6ee0bc360b697c8526d3754af0f8cd329bb5d OP_EQUAL
address
3NuAfYD8V4yrRshHkiAL1sLGN9fDdELwrp
transaction
e8c6c47d29fe8a4007978758be964fa8663b9cc05ac6b251580f07b4453a1671
confirmations
369310
spent
true